117.info
人生若只如初见

Java中arraylist排序怎么实现

Java中可以使用Collections.sort()方法对ArrayList进行排序,具体实现步骤如下:

  1. 首先导入java.util.Collections类,该类提供了一些静态方法用于对集合进行排序。
import java.util.Collections;
  1. 创建一个ArrayList对象,并向其中添加元素。
ArrayList list = new ArrayList();
list.add(5);
list.add(3);
list.add(8);
list.add(1);
  1. 使用Collections.sort()方法对ArrayList进行排序。
Collections.sort(list);
  1. 输出排序后的ArrayList。
System.out.println(list);

完整的排序代码如下:

import java.util.ArrayList;
import java.util.Collections;
public class ArrayListSort {
public static void main(String[] args) {
ArrayList list = new ArrayList();
list.add(5);
list.add(3);
list.add(8);
list.add(1);
Collections.sort(list);
System.out.println(list);
}
}

输出结果为:

[1, 3, 5, 8]

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e16fAzsLBwRVBlY.html

推荐文章

  • java中的arraylist怎么使用

    在Java中,ArrayList是一个动态数组,可以存储任意类型的数据。以下是使用ArrayList的一些常见操作: 导入ArrayList类: import java.util.ArrayList; 创建Array...

  • java怎么创建arraylist集合

    要创建 ArrayList 集合,可以按照以下步骤进行操作: 首先,在代码中导入 java.util.ArrayList 类。 import java.util.ArrayList; 然后,声明一个 ArrayList 对象...

  • Java中ArrayList类常用方法和遍历是什么

    Java中ArrayList类的常用方法包括: add(E element):向列表末尾添加一个元素。 add(int index, E element):在指定位置插入一个元素。 remove(int index):移除...

  • java中ArrayList的排序方法有哪些

    在Java中,ArrayList类提供了多种排序方法,可以根据不同的需求选择适合的排序方法。以下是常用的ArrayList排序方法: Collections.sort(ArrayList):使用默认的...

  • Linux的getsockopt( )函数怎么使用

    getsockopt()函数用于获取套接字选项的值。
    函数原型为:
    int getsockopt(int sockfd, int level, int optname, void *optval, socklen_t *optlen); 参...

  • c语言静态变量的特点有哪些

    C语言中的静态变量具有以下特点: 生命周期长:静态变量在程序运行期间始终存在,不会随着函数的调用而销毁。它们的值在函数调用之间保持不变。 作用域局限:静态...

  • c语言关键字static的作用是什么

    在C语言中,关键字static有以下几种作用: 静态变量:static关键字可以用于声明静态变量,静态变量存储在静态存储区,在程序运行期间一直存在,其作用域为局部作...

  • java中静态方法如何调用

    在Java中,可以通过以下两种方式来调用静态方法: 使用类名调用静态方法:可以直接通过类名来调用静态方法,不需要创建类的实例。语法为:类名.静态方法名(参数列...